We are seeking a skilled Android Developer to join our team in a hybrid role based in Pretoria. The ideal candidate will have 2+ years of experience in Kotlin and native Android development using Kotlin and Java, with strong expertise in Reactive Programming and modern design patterns such as MVP, MVVM, and Clean Architecture. You should be proficient in UI development, RESTful API integration, and lifecycle management, with a solid understanding of threading, storage mechanisms, and Git.
Experience with RxAndroid, RxJava, RxKotlin, and Bluetooth development on Android is beneficial, along with familiarity with Agile environments and Atlassian JIRA. I
Requirements
Minimum education (essential): National Senior Certificate
Minimum education (desirable): Diploma and/or degree in IT / Engineering / Programming
Minimum applicable experience (years): 5 years as an Android Developer
Required nature of experience:
Hands on software developer having been responsible for the development and maintenance of 1 or more projects.
Skills and Knowledge (essential):
MNCJobs.co.za will not be responsible for any payment made to a third-party. All Terms of Use are applicable.